POTSDAM, N.Y.—The SUNY Potsdam Athletic Department will hold a Maroon Out during the Bears basketball and hockey games against Plattsburgh State on Friday, February 10.
Fans are encouraged to wear maroon to the men's and women's basketball games scheduled for 5:30 p.m. and 7:30 p.m. as well as the men's hockey game at 7 p.m. Those in need of new Bears gear can stop by the College Bookstore on game day for a 25 percent discount on all maroon apparel and hats that not already on sale.
The same night, tables will be set up for donations for the family of local businessman Jeff James. James was recently diagnosed with Stage 3 brain cancer. Funds raised will go toward medical, food and travel costs for Jeff and his family. In addition to being the owner of Special Tee Printing, James is also a longtime supporter of local youth sports as a coach and official. In the fall, he is a collegiate soccer referee and has officiated multiple Bears contests.
